What is the digital signature lawfulness for operations in Mexico
The digital signature lawfulness for operations in Mexico refers to the legal framework that recognizes and validates electronic signatures as equivalent to handwritten signatures. This law ensures that digital signatures can be used in various transactions, providing the same legal standing as traditional signatures. It is governed by the Federal Law on Electronic Signature, which outlines the requirements and conditions for the use of digital signatures in commercial and official dealings.

Legal use of the digital signature lawfulness for operations in Mexico
The legal use of digital signatures in Mexico is supported by the Federal Law on Electronic Signature, which establishes that electronic signatures hold the same legal weight as handwritten signatures. This law applies to various sectors, including business transactions, contracts, and official documents. It is crucial for users to ensure that their digital signatures are applied correctly to maintain legal compliance and enforceability.
